Abstract
A fuel tank (,) has an ejector pump (,) arranged inside it. This ejector pump (,) is preloaded against an inner wall (,) of the fuel tank (,) by means of a flexurally elastic supporting arm (,) and is thus fixed. This allows the ejector pump (,) to be inserted into the interior of the fuel tank (,) without problems through an opening (,) together with a fuel feed unit (,). This considerably simplifies the fitting of the ejector pump (,) and, in particular, there is no need for another fitting opening in the fuel tank (,) to enable the ejector pump (,) to be fixed.
